Towns being Washed Away in Bangladesh

06.26.2008
It's getting wet in Bangladesh

The impovished nation of Bangladesh has a new and menacing problem: rising waters are washing away entire villages. While the life giving monsoons and network of rivers in this South Asian country have supported agriculture for centuries, those same waters are now forcing thousands to flee their homes forever. Errosion of riverbanks and rising sea levels mean that entire villages are being forced to move. Villagers are literally taking their communities apart piece by piece.
